Fence Supply Stores in Cape Town: Services and Practicalities
<pFence supply stores in Cape Town, Western Cape, offer a practical hub for homeowners, developers and builders seeking fencing solutions. The stock commonly spans a range of materials such as galvanised and powder-coated steel, aluminium, timber, PVC and composite panels. Selection is influenced by climate considerations, coastal air exposure and local aesthetic preferences, with many outlets carrying items suitable for both security and decorative purposes. The emphasis is on readily available components that enable both DIY initiatives and professional installations.
<pTypical services include advice on suitable fencing profiles, gates and accessories, with staff often able to discuss durability, maintenance needs and installation considerations. Customers can expect guidance on corrosion resistance in coastal environments, the benefits of powder coatings, and options for anti-climb designs. For those planning security-focused upgrades, products such as high-security mesh, palisade fencing and reinforced steel are commonly available, along with access control gear and motorised or manual gate mechanisms.
<pA core aspect of the service offering is materials measurement and planning support. Customers are encouraged to bring or obtain accurate site dimensions, enabling staff to estimate materials, order lengths and confirm compatibility with existing structures. In many outlets, a quotation or written estimate is provided after a casual site survey or by supplying standard calculation guidelines. This helps ensure that the correct quantity of posts, rails, panels and fixings are procured, minimising waste and delays.
<pDelivery and collection arrangements form another practical consideration. Stores typically offer bulk deliveries, sometimes subject to minimum order values or distance-based charges. For larger projects, some outlets coordinate with local carriers or partner installers to streamline the supply-to-installation process. Ready-to-install components such as pre-cut trellis sections, fencing panels and gate kits are commonly stocked to support faster project timelines.
Installation is frequently offered as a serviced option, either through the store’s own installation teams or preferred contractor networks. Customers should expect clear scheduling, from initial measurements to site access and final adjustments. Depending on the scope, installation may require ground preparation, post-setting, concrete footings and alignment checks to ensure gates operate smoothly and securely. For the more adventurous DIY customers, stores typically provide technical information, fastening hardware recommendations and practical guidance, while encouraging adherence to local regulations and safety practices.
<pMaintenance considerations are routinely highlighted. Wire and metal fencing may require rust prevention, periodic re-coating and checks on fasteners, whilst timber fences commonly benefit from protective treatments against moisture, UV exposure and pests. In coastal settings, advice on galvanised coatings, corrosion-resistant hardware and routine cleaning helps extend the lifespan of fencing investments.
Practical factors such as access restrictions, privacy needs, noise reduction, and landscaping integration are often discussed. Cape Town’s varied neighbourhoods mean options range from low-level decorative borders to higher-security solutions for perimeters. Local building regulations, homeowners’ association requirements and planning considerations may influence fence height and design, making informed consultation valuable. Overall, fence supply stores in the region strive to provide a balanced mix of affordability, durability and style, supported by knowledgeable staff and flexible service options to meet diverse project needs.
